Hi

I have a pocket pc and i am buying a pcmcia expansion pack for it so i can use my wireless LAN card to pick up the network at college... only thing is though is that the college is all macs.... so runs of macs "airport" network, will i still be able to pick up the wireless connection?

Thanks
